Transaction 57522172d1c8aa625eb79ff978c2916b86ac9d86da4703f33c611319fab77882
1 Input
1 Output
-
57522172d1c8aa625eb79ff978c2916b86ac9d86da4703f33c611319fab77882: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 1dcf9c073adfce8c022cfc2adfc6a8d8e63569fb9905b12e0e1dfd89bf6eddc5
- address
- bc1prh8ecpe6ml8gcq3vls4dl34gmrnr260mnyzmztswrh7cn0mwmhzsw2l40u